Davis has a certain personality that impacts solar choices. Rooflines differ from older cattle ranch homes and mid-century residential properties to more recent constructs with complicated hips, dormers, and shaded sections. Tree cover issues right here greater than some purchasers realize. Fully grown color trees become part of the allure of lots of Davis neighborhoods, yet they can materially transform manufacturing. A great installer will certainly model that color meticulously and discuss the trade-offs. A weak one may play down it and hand you a production quote that looks excellent in a proposal however lets down in real life.
Utility plan likewise forms the business economics. Net payment regulations, time-of-use prices, and the expanding value of battery storage space mean solar propositions ought to not look the like they did a few years ago. If an installer still sells as though every kilowatt-hour exported to the grid is as important as one eaten in the house, that is an indicator the sales method is lagging behind existing conditions.
Then there is allowing and inspection. A business that on a regular basis handles solar installers Davis tasks will usually recognize neighborhood assumptions much better than a remote sales group attempting to systematize every task throughout California. That local familiarity does not guarantee quality, however it often implies less avoidable delays.
Homeowners usually ask the incorrect initial inquiry: "What is your price per watt?" That number can be valuable, yet it is not the area to start. commercial solar installers Davis The initial concern must be whether the system being proposed actually fits your home and your goals.
Some people want to offset as much annual intake as possible. Others intend to minimize summertime height costs. Some anticipate to buy an electric vehicle within a year. Others function from home and use power differently than a home that is empty the majority of the day. Battery storage might be necessary if durability matters to you, however lesser if your major goal is economic return and your interruption history is minimal.
A thoughtful installer will certainly inquire about all of this prior to presenting a design. If the rep hurries to a quote without comprehending your usage patterns, future plans, roof covering condition, and budget constraints, the proposal might be brightened yet shallow.
I have actually seen home owners receive 3 quotes for the exact same address that were extremely various. One suggested a large system on the west-facing roof just, an additional split modules throughout south and east planes to smooth production, and a 3rd advised a smaller sized variety plus a battery since the household had heavy evening intake. All three could be protected, yet only one lined up with exactly how the family in fact utilized electrical energy. That is why fit needs to come first.

A solar proposition should do greater than reveal a month-to-month settlement and a cost savings estimate. It must let you understand what is being set up, where it will go, what it is expected to generate, and what presumptions were used.
The better proposals normally include an equipment listing with exact component and inverter versions, a site layout, yearly manufacturing estimate, service warranty summary, and a clear explanation of any type of recognized exclusions. If your roof covering is older, there must be a discussion concerning staying roofing life. If your major panel is complete or undersized, that ought to be reviewed before contract trademark, not as a shock change order after permitting.
Production estimates should have unique attention. These numbers are commonly based upon software program, which is useful, yet the quality of the estimate relies on the top quality of the inputs. A representative who never saw the residential property, never asked for images, and never gone over shielding may still produce an appealing quote. Appealing is not the same as reliable.
A well-prepared proposal also acknowledges uncertainty. Genuine manufacturing can vary based on weather condition, dust, smoke, panel positioning, shading growth, and house owner actions. A skilled installer discusses that variety as opposed to acting the estimate is a guarantee.
Homeowners are frequently pressed right into brand comparisons before the fundamentals are settled. Costs panel versus common panel can matter, yet usually not as much as format high quality, inverter strategy, workmanship, and after-install support.
Panels from respectable manufacturers often tend to be extra alike than sales pitches suggest. Efficiency distinctions are genuine, however on lots of homes the deciding variable is not a one- or two-point efficiency edge. It is whether your roof has actually limited functional location, whether shade needs module-level optimization, and whether visual appeals are essential adequate to justify a premium.
Inverters are where the conversation commonly gets even more useful. Some homes gain from microinverters, especially where roofing airplanes face various instructions or partial shade influences a part of modules. Other jobs pencil out well with string inverters and optimizers. There is no widely best style. There is only the design that finest matches the roof and operating conditions.
Battery storage space requires much more treatment. In Davis, batteries can enhance self-consumption and resilience, however the ideal battery size depends on what you intend to back up. Running a refrigerator, lights, internet, and a few electrical outlets is a really different layout trouble than trying to lug central air conditioning with a summer evening failure. Installers that provide a battery as an easy add-on often leave house owners puzzled about real backup capability.

This is the component many house owners barely think about until the process delays. Solar jobs do stagnate from signed contract to operating system in a straight line. There are layout modifications, allow remarks, scheduling problems, utility documentation, evaluations, and occasionally devices schedule problems.
A seasoned installer will certainly establish expectations truthfully. If they promise an unrealistically rapid timeline just to safeguard the contract, aggravation generally follows. Davis property owners need to expect some variability. Climate, city review volume, energy interconnection timing, and site-specific electric work all play a role.
What matters most is not whether the business regulates every variable, due to the fact that they do not. What issues is whether they take care of the process proactively and keep you notified. Silence is just one of one of the most usual issues in solar projects. Home owners can tolerate a delay far better than they can endure not knowing why the hold-up exists.

Solar is not an isolated purchase. It remains on a roofing system, connections right into an electrical system, and needs to coexist with the home you currently have. That seems obvious, however several unsatisfactory solar experiences start when these essentials are ignored.
If your roof has only a few years of life left, mounting solar first typically develops future expense and hassle. Removing and re-installing panels later is not insignificant. Excellent installers will tell you that. They may also encourage roof work before the job proceeds. It is not the answer some property owners desire, but it is usually the ideal one.
Electrical panels are another usual issue. Older homes might require upgrades to support the project safely and code-compliantly. This can add purposeful cost. A responsible installer increases that possibility very early and explains the most likely range. A less cautious one may treat it as a surprise. Neither you nor the installer can know every website condition beforehand, yet experienced firms are typically much better at identifying likely complications.
A couple of years earlier, lots of property solar conversations concentrated almost completely on straightforward power balanced out. That technique is less total now. For lots of California homeowners, a solar-only system and a solar-plus-storage system need to be contrasted in a much more nuanced way.
A battery can help you keep more of your solar energy for evening usage, which can matter under time-of-use prices and reduced export value. It can additionally give backup power, but only within the limitations of the system design. Not every battery configuration backs up the whole home, and numerous do not. This is where homeowners need clear explanations, not marketing shorthand.
In Davis, where summer warm can make late-day air conditioning important, battery sizing and lots preparation are entitled to cautious focus. If your family anticipates backup for clinical tools, refrigeration, internet, and some air conditioning, the design ought to show those concerns. A firm that treats battery storage as a common upsell is refraining from doing sufficient style work.
By the moment the proposal looks appealing, several house owners are tired of contrasting and wish to carry on. That is precisely when contract language deserves a more detailed read.
Look for quality on payment milestones, tools substitution, estimated versus ensured manufacturing, solution duties, and termination rights where applicable. Check out the workmanship warranty section very carefully. A long devices warranty from the supplier works, yet lots of real-world troubles involve labor, roofing system penetrations, electrical wiring, surveillance, or commissioning concerns. Those are usually controlled by the installer's workmanship commitment, not the panel spec sheet.
Also ask what occurs if the firm changes ownership or stops procedures. No installer likes this inquiry, but it is fair. Solar is a long-lived property. The assistance structure matters.
